Output 1ac38a41bac6c756bf6914bd0291c14cddbfc95e10a42981134b4b5216d0972e:8

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2273533babad315036e5810a19b90553a8ec00d3 OP_EQUAL
address
34qB3zkHx151jWGQhz1uLGJoDDMLBzmTbF
transaction
1ac38a41bac6c756bf6914bd0291c14cddbfc95e10a42981134b4b5216d0972e
spent
true